Thoughts about SETI and SETI@home
I think the SETI@home project is a wonderful idea. The monumental amount of data which has to be processed could never be done in a reasonable amount of time, so using a distributed processing network makes wonderful sense (however one hopes the Social Security Administration or the IRS never decides to implement a similar system to cut down on their computational time and resources).

Do I believe in extra-terrestrial life? Yes. Given the recent evidence that bacteria can survive damned near any place in the universe, plus the number of solar systems with planets, life in some form or another out there statistically has to exist. Does that life look like us or ET? I don't know. But I'm guessing there's more single cell life out there than you can shake a stick at. I hope we'll get a better idea if there's intelligent, communicative life out there as well within my lifetime. So you people have (based on statistics) another 33 years to do it.
